Hi everyone.
Just picked up a 08 Z06. Had a 03 Z that I sold about 4 years ago. It was a H/C and nitrous car. Always wanted a C6 Z.
She is black with chrome wheels. Has 24k miles.
H/C/I new clutch, 2” AR headers with cats. All work was done by CPR. Made 575whp 510 wtq.
She drives great for a big cam car.
The intake is a Fast 102.
i will be powder coating the wheels black next week.
Good to be back.

Looks nice! NT05R's out back? Should hook hard. From pros I have talked to. Maybe I'm wrong or right. You can't powder coat the chromies black.. many reasons it can't be done without ruining the rims. Just from the pros I have talked to. The chrome is too thin to strip on the aluminum. Other things I can't recall. This was a few years ago so I can't remember all the reasons. Plastidip for fun?
